Automated Trading Strategy: Following the Volume Indices with ZLEMA and Shadows on FXI
Based on the backtesting results statistics for the trading strategy conducted from November 2, 2022, to November 2, 2023, the overall performance reveals a profit factor of 0.81. This indicates that for every dollar invested, the strategy generated $0.81 in profits. However, the annualized ROI (Return on Investment) stands at -6.61%, suggesting a negative return during the specified period. On average, trades were held for approximately 4 days and 19 hours, and the average number of trades executed per week was 0.51. The total number of closed trades amounted to 27, with only 22.22% of these trades resulting in favorable outcomes. Thus, improvements in the strategy may be necessary to achieve more positive investment results.

Unlocking FXI's Potential with Golden Cross: A Step-By-Step Guide
- Identify the 50-day moving average and the 200-day moving average for FXI.
- If the 50-day moving average crosses above the 200-day moving average, it is a bullish signal.
- Consider entering a long position on FXI when the golden cross occurs.
- Set a stop-loss order below the recent swing low for risk management.
- Monitor the price action and adjust the stop-loss order accordingly as the trade progresses.
- Take profits or partially close the position if the price reaches a predetermined target level.
- Review the trade and evaluate the overall performance of using the golden cross strategy.
Golden Cross Analysis Timeframes for FXI
When analyzing the Golden Cross, it is important to consider timeframes. Short-term analysis using a 20-day moving average can provide signals for immediate trading decisions. However, it may result in false signals due to market volatility. Medium-term analysis using a 50-day moving average can help identify broader market trends. This timeframe is commonly used by swing traders. Long-term analysis using a 200-day moving average can offer insights into the overall health of a stock or ETF. The Golden Cross is seen as more reliable when it occurs on longer timeframes, as it indicates a significant shift in market sentiment. For example, the Golden Cross on the 200-day moving average of FXI could signal a potential upward trend in the Chinese large-cap market.

Utilizing Golden Cross for FXI Investment Insights
When making investment decisions for the FXI, one useful technical analysis tool to consider is the golden cross. The golden cross occurs when a short-term moving average crosses above a long-term moving average, indicating a bullish trend. Traders often see this as a signal to buy. For example, if the 50-day moving average crosses above the 200-day moving average, it could indicate an upward trend for the FXI. This can be further supported by other technical indicators and fundamental analysis of the Chinese market. However, it's important to consider other factors such as market conditions and geopolitical risks before making any investment decisions. Using the golden cross as a part of your investment strategy can help you navigate the dynamic nature of the FXI and potentially increase your chances of making profitable trades.

To backtest a Golden Cross strategy for FXI, follow these steps:
1. Select a time period for analysis, like five years.
2. Identify the Golden Cross signal, which occurs when the 50-day moving average crosses above the 200-day moving average.
3. Track the buy and sell signals based on this crossover.
4. Calculate returns by buying when the Golden Cross is signaled and selling when it reverses.
5. Compare the strategy's performance against a benchmark, such as a buy-and-hold approach or a different trading strategy.
6. Analyze the results to determine the strategy's effectiveness and make any necessary adjustments.
